Choosing the Proper Hydrangea Selection
Selecting the perfect hydrangea selection on your backyard is essential to make sure its success. With over 70 species and numerous cultivars to select from, it may be overwhelming to navigate the choices. This is a complete information that can assist you choose the very best hydrangea on your particular wants and preferences:
Dimension and Form
Take into account the house obtainable in your backyard and the specified measurement and form of your hydrangea. Sizes vary from compact dwarf varieties to towering shrubs, with heights various from 2 to fifteen ft or extra. Select a range that matches the designated space with out overcrowding or underperforming.
Bloom Kind
Hydrangeas showcase all kinds of bloom varieties, together with lacecaps, mopheads, and panicles. Mopheads are characterised by their rounded, globe-shaped clusters of flowers, whereas lacecaps characteristic central fertile flowers surrounded by a hoop of showy sterile flowers. Panicle hydrangeas produce upright, cone-shaped blooms.
Flower Colour
Maybe essentially the most hanging facet of hydrangeas is their vivid flower coloration. Whereas many types naturally produce blue or pink blooms, the colour could be manipulated by way of soil pH adjustment. Acidic soils promote blue flowers, whereas alkaline soils favor pink shades. Some varieties even boast color-changing blooms that transition between blue and pink all through the season.
Bloom Kind | Flower Form |
---|---|
Lacecap | Central fertile flowers surrounded by showy sterile flowers |
Mophead | Rounded, globe-shaped clusters of flowers |
Panicle | Upright, cone-shaped blooms |
Selecting the Finest Planting Web site
The important thing to profitable hydrangea progress lies in choosing a really perfect planting website that fulfills their particular environmental necessities. These charming shrubs thrive in settings that meet their wants for ample daylight, ample moisture, and optimum soil situations.
Daylight
Hydrangeas exhibit various preferences for daylight publicity. Perceive the precise necessities of your chosen selection to make sure optimum progress.
- Bigleaf Hydrangeas: These cultivars thrive greatest in partial shade, receiving roughly 4-6 hours of dappled daylight per day.
- Panicle Hydrangeas: These varieties tolerate full solar or partial shade, performing nicely with at the very least 6 hours of direct daylight.
- Mountain Hydrangeas: As woodland natives, mountain hydrangeas desire keen on full shade, requiring solely 2-4 hours of direct daylight.
Moisture
Hydrangeas have a fame for being thirsty vegetation, requiring constantly moist soil to flourish. Nonetheless, they abhor waterlogged situations, which may result in root rot and stunted progress.

Troubleshooting Widespread Hydrangea Points
1. Wilting or Yellowing Leaves
Trigger: Insufficient watering, inadequate daylight, or overfertilizing.
Resolution: Water the plant deeply, present extra or filtered daylight, and scale back fertilizer utility.
2. Brown Leaf Edges
Trigger: Lack of moisture or excessive salt content material in soil.
Resolution: Water totally and leach the soil with water to take away extra salt.
3. Sparse Blooming
Trigger: Incorrect pruning, lack of daylight, nitrogen deficiency.
Resolution: Prune accurately, present ample daylight, and fertilize with a nitrogen-rich fertilizer.
